Why choose a two-bedroom apartment in a senior living community?
Two-bedroom apartments in senior living communities have become increasingly popular among retirees for several reasons. Firstly, they offer more space compared to studio or one-bedroom units, allowing residents to maintain a sense of comfort and familiarity. The extra room can serve as a guest bedroom for visiting family members, a home office, or a hobby room. Additionally, couples who prefer separate sleeping arrangements due to different schedules or health issues find two-bedroom apartments ideal for their needs.

How do senior living communities support the health and well-being of elderly residents?
Senior living communities prioritize the health and well-being of their residents through various means. Many communities offer on-site healthcare services, including regular check-ups, medication management, and emergency response systems. Additionally, they often provide wellness programs that focus on physical fitness, nutrition, and mental health. Social activities and events are organized to combat isolation and promote a sense of community among residents. Some communities also offer specialized care for those with specific health conditions, such as memory care for individuals with dementia or Alzheimer’s disease.
What factors should seniors consider when choosing a two-bedroom apartment in a retirement community?
When selecting a two-bedroom apartment in a senior living community, several factors should be taken into account:
-
Location: Proximity to family, friends, and familiar surroundings
-
Cost: Monthly fees, including rent, utilities, and services
-
Level of care: Available medical services and assistance with daily activities
-
Community culture: Social atmosphere and types of activities offered
-
Apartment layout: Accessibility features and overall comfort
-
Contract terms: Understanding the financial commitments and policies
-
Future needs: Ability to transition to higher levels of care if needed
-
Reputation: Reviews and testimonials from current residents and their families
